Output e221d7c896f2bcfeebf073e5eedafd09c3cf94050d6b0e3dc6faa4242dfd0b63:0

value
953078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b9e618407c24db7d7b1af734a1899bb530c5de5 OP_EQUAL
address
38arLRuv2ZdqHHAHzDGL3y6ayWbd9aBEFx
transaction
e221d7c896f2bcfeebf073e5eedafd09c3cf94050d6b0e3dc6faa4242dfd0b63
confirmations
261119
spent
true